Key Considerations When Choosing Best Mobile Phone
Performance and Processing Power

The processor is the brain on your mobile phone. A good processor ensures smooth multitasking, fast application and effective power when using.
See modern chipset such as Snapdragon 7 or 8 Series, Mediatek Demislas or Apple’s A-Series.
Averages 6 GB of RAM is recommended for average users, while 8 GB or more players and power are ideal for users.
Instead of fully relying on numbers, check for a review or scale for Real -world performance.
The performance should match your use. If you mainly use your phone for messages, surfing and social media, the middle -cut kit will be sufficient. For gaming or video editing, go for advanced processors.

Battery Life and Charging Speed
Battery life is often underestimated, but is one of the most important functions of daily use.
Dimensions for at least 4,500 mAh battery capacity.
Fast charging (30W or more) is very useful, especially for busy users.
Wireless charging and reverse charging are added for premium phones.
Do not completely trust the size of the battery; Effective software adjustment can make a big difference in battery life in the real world.
Display Quality
The performance is what you interact the most, so don’t go to a chord here.
The AMOLED and OLED screen provide better contrast and color than the standard LCD.
A minimum full HD+ resolution is required for a sharp view.
The high fresh frequency (90Hz, 120Hz) makes rolling smooth, especially for gaming and video consumption.
Also think about the size and glow of the screen if you watch many videos or use the phone.
Software and User Experience
Choosing the best mobile phone means considering software experience.
Stock Android offers a clean, blotware-free interface. Brands like Google and Motorola stick to this approach.
Some brands such as Samsung or OnePlus offer UI customized with additional features.
Make sure the brand provides regular software updates and security updates.
The software plays a big role in long -term satisfaction, so choose a phone that comes with a good track record of updates.
Build Quality and Durability
Smartphones are tools for daily use and must meet regular wear.
Look for materials such as gorilla class and metal or reinforced plastic frames.
IP rankings (eg IP67 or IP68) provide water and dust resistance.
A solid construction increases the unit and life of the unit.
In addition, make sure service centers and support are available located if the repair is required.
